Navasota is a genus of snout moths described by Émile Louis Ragonot in 1887.[1][2]
Species[]
- Navasota chionophlebia Hampson, 1918
- Navasota discipunctella Hampson, 1918
- Navasota haemaphaeella Hampson, 1918
- Navasota hebetella Ragonot, 1887
- Navasota leuconeurella Hampson, 1918
- Navasota myriolecta Dyar, 1914
- Navasota persectella Hampson, 1918
- Navasota syriggia Hampson, 1918
